Revenue and income statement

In 2024, SOCIETE COMMERCIALE DE LA PLAINE DU CAIRE achieves revenue of 4.6 M€. Over the period 2016-2024, the company shows strong growth with a CAGR (compound annual growth rate) of +7.5%. Vs 2023: +5%. After deducting consumption (953 k€), gross margin stands at 3.6 M€, i.e. a rate of 79%. This ratio measures the ability to generate value from commercial activity. EBITDA (= Gross margin - Personnel expenses - Taxes) reaches 298 k€, representing 6.5% of revenue. Positive scissor effect: EBITDA margin improves by +2.4 pts, sign of improved operational efficiency. The operating margin remains fragile, requiring cost vigilance. Ultimately, net income (= EBIT +/- financial result +/- exceptional - corporate tax) amounts to 24 k€, i.e. 0.5% of revenue. This profit can be retained or distributed to shareholders.

Solvency and debt ratios

The debt ratio (= Financial debt / Equity x 100) stands at 81%. Debt level is high: negotiating margin with banks is reduced. Financial autonomy (= Equity / Total assets x 100) reaches 20%. Low autonomy: the company heavily depends on external financing (banks, suppliers). Debt repayment capacity (= Financial debt / Cash flow) indicates it would take 1.0 years of cash flow to repay all financial debt. This short period demonstrates excellent debt sustainability. Cash flow represents 5.8% of revenue. Cash flow measures resources generated by operations, available for investment and debt repayment. Satisfactory level allowing partial financing of growth.

Working capital requirement (WCR) and payment terms

Working capital requirement (WCR) measures the cash timing gap between customer collections and supplier/inventory payments. Average customer payment term: 70 days (formula: Customer receivables / Revenue incl. VAT x 360). Supplier term: 76 days. Favorable situation: supplier credit is longer than customer credit by 6 days. Inventory turnover is 1 days (= Average inventory / Cost of goods x 360). Fast turnover, sign of good inventory management. Overall, WCR represents 49 days of revenue, i.e. 616 k€ to permanently finance. Over 2016-2024, WCR increased by +91%, requiring additional financing.

How is this estimate calculated?

This estimate is based on the analysis of 50 actual transactions of similar company sales (same NAF code) registered with BODACC between 2016 and 2025.

  • EBITDA Multiple: Preferred method for profitable SMEs. EBITDA reflects the ability to generate cash.
  • Revenue Multiple: Used for growing companies or those with low profitability. Reflects commercial potential.
  • Net Income Multiple: Relevant for mature companies with stable results.

This estimate is provided for information purposes only. A precise valuation requires in-depth analysis (assets, liabilities, prospects, market...).
